J 7i) :_ *\ :..L ;\ HIGH CC-L]AT\E i.,rALAr I ' I I Compensation Awarded by the Tribunat Compensation Awarded (Setttement Reached) in the Lok Adatat SER HIGH COURT LOK ADALAT 5 J v * State ol1 Apportionment of Compensation, if AWARD Rs.6,05,000/- (Rupees Six lakhs five thousand onty) with costs and interest @ .7.5% per annum from the date of petition i.e., 05-02-2015 titt the date of realization of the amount. l-his MACI{A has been preferred by the Corporation /APSRTC aggrieved by the Award passed in MVOP No.1170 of 2015 hy the Motor Accidents Ctaims l-ribunat-cum-the Court of the Chief Judge, City Civit Courts, Hyderabad. liri T.Kuta Sekhar Reddy, Law Officer of APSRTC and the Respondent/Petitioner I'os. 1 & 2 atong with their counset have appeared before the Lok Adatat During the pendency of this Appeal, both the parties reported comprornise aM entered into a settlement and in view of the same, the Respondent/Pedtioner ){os.1 & 2 have agreed to reduce principat award amount i.e., from R;.6,05,000/- to Rs.4,84,000/- and interest fnrm 7.5% to 6% per annum. As such, the Corporation /APSRTC has agreed to pay Rs.4,84,@0/- (Rupees Four takhs eighty-four thousand onty) with the reduced interest i.e., @ 6% per arrnum from the date of petition tilt the date of reatization. lt is submitted that 50% of the amount is atready deposited by the Corporation/APSRTC. Due c.edit shatt be given to the amounts atready paid white payment of settlement alount. Accordingty, compromise is recorded and the case is settted before the Lok Adatat. ln view of the above setttement, the Corporation/APSRTC shalt deposit the arnount within two (2) months from the date of receipt of copy of Award, after deducting the amount that was deposited, if any. ln the event of defautt or deLay in making such deposit, the Respondents/Petitioners/Claimants are entitted to ctaim interest as awarded by the lower court/ Tribunat. The apportionment among the Respondents/Ctaim Petitioner Nos.'t and 2 shatl be made as per the terms of the award passed in MVOP.No.1170 of 2015 by the Tnbuna[/court betow.
